What’s the Average Size of Solar Panels?
The standard dimensions have become universal for contemporary residential solar panels. Here's the average:
- Dimensions: 65 inches x 39 inches (approximately 5.4 feet x 3.25 feet)
- Surface Area Requirement: One panel requires 17.5 square feet of surface area.
- Thickness: Around 1.5 to 2 inches
The measurements of 65 inches x 39 inches fit the standard size range for 60-cell solar panels used widely in residential property installations.
The standard installation equipment at commercial facilities consists of 72-cell panels because they measure 77 inches x 39 inches.
How Much Do Solar Panels Weigh?
- Weight is another critical factor, especially if you’re doing a rooftop installation.
- Average weight: 40 pounds per panel (for 60-cell)
- Commercial panels: 50 pounds or more
The weight of each solar panel amounts to only around a few pounds, but if you deploy twenty to thirty panels on your roof, they will sustain between eight hundred to one thousand two hundred pounds of weight. The reasons why professional installers need to inspect the roof before putting it in place include these factors.
How Many Panels Will You Need?
The number of panels you need depends on:
- Your household's electricity usage
- The wattage rating of the panels
- How much sunlight your location gets
- The orientation and tilt of your roof
Residential electricity use in the United States reaches about 10,000 kWh per year, so 20–30 properly established solar panels would typically meet this need under standard environmental conditions.

How Much Roof Space Do You Need?
To cover your energy needs with a solar installation, you should consider using 24 solar panels designed for your particular energy requirements. For operations, you need 420 square feet with an area allocation of 17.5 square feet per panel.
But that’s just the start. Your installer also needs to account for:
- Ventilation gaps
- Obstructions like chimneys or skylights
- Orientation (south-facing is ideal in the northern hemisphere)
That’s why a professional assessment is crucial before making any commitments.
Can My Roof Support the Weight?
Modern houses generally carry the weight of solar panels without issues, though weak or aged constructions may demand structural reinforcement.
A good installer will:
- Inspect your roof for structural integrity
- Consider the age and condition of the roofing materials
- Ensure there’s no underlying damage before installation
If your roof needs replacing soon, it’s wise to do it before you install solar. This avoids the hassle of uninstalling and reinstalling later.

Portable and Compact Solar Panel Options
For RVs, tiny homes, or backup power, compact or portable solar panels are available. These may be:
- Foldable or suitcase-style panels
- Weighs only 10–20 pounds
- Size ranges from 2–4 square feet
While these won't power an entire home, they’re perfect for small-scale or mobile use.
